Hardware Support for Above 4G Decoding

Above 4G Decoding works with different motherboards, depending on the CPU and chipset. For AMD Ryzen 5000, look for motherboards with AMD B550 or X570. Intel users can use Z490 and sometimes Z390 and servers. Make sure your motherboard supports it and turn it on in the BIOS.

ASUS Z270-P and Z270-A Motherboards

With ASUS Z270-P and Z270-A boards, you need to change some BIOS settings for mining to work well. This involves switching on Above 4G Decoding and tweaking a few different settings.

One change is setting the Primary Display to CPU Graphics in the Graphics Configuration for Z270-P. Then, in the PCI Express Configuration, you adjust the DMI Max Link Speed and Link Speeds for certain items. It’s also a good idea to stop the HD Audio Controller and Serial Port 1 in the Onboard Devices settings5.

Setting ‘Restore AC Power Loss’ to Power ON in the APM Configuration is another important step. This way, if you lose power, the system restarts itself, keeping your mining going5.

Turning off ‘Fast Boot’ and switching on Above 4G Decoding within the Boot menu, specifically for Z270-P, is vital5. After all changes, save by choosing ‘Save Changes & Reset’ to apply them properly for better mining performance.

Considerations for Enabling Above 4G Decoding

Before you turn on Above 4G Decoding, remember a few things. It might cause problems for some users, so it’s good to update your drivers and BIOS first8. Also, using Above 4G Decoding might need more RAM. Make sure you have enough before you start4.

Above 4G Decoding is a must for good gaming with Resizable Bar. It boosts how well games run by letting them use more memory and cutting down on delays4.

People who are really into tech say there are special UEFI settings needed for Above 4G Decoding to work well with mining GPUs8. You might need to set things like >4G base addresses to get it working right.

Also, some ASRock Intel boards have a special TOLUD setting. It helps manage memory more precisely. This can be great for tricky GPU setups8.

If you plan to use custom ROMs with bad UEFI signatures, you might need to tinker with the CSM settings. Make sure everything is set up right for it to work perfectly8.
